1032871855 has 4 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 1239446232. Its totient is φ = 826297480.
The previous prime is 1032871849. The next prime is 1032871891. The reversal of 1032871855 is 5581782301.
It is a semiprime because it is the product of two primes.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 1032871855 - 211 = 1032869807 is a prime.
It is a super-2 number, since 2×10328718552 = 2133648537702282050, which contains 22 as substring.
It is a Smith number, since the sum of its digits (40) coincides with the sum of the digits of its prime factors. Since it is squarefree, it is also a hoax number.
It is a Duffinian number.
It is a congruent number.
It is an unprimeable number.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(19)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 3 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 103287181 + ... + 103287190.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(309861558).
Almost surely, 21032871855 is an apocalyptic number.
1032871855 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(206574377).
1032871855 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
1032871855 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 206574376.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 67200, while the sum is 40.
The square root of 1032871855 is about 32138.3237739618. The cubic root of 1032871855 is about 1010.8393685762.
